الملخص EN

In this paper, an epidemic model with no full immunity is analyzed on semidirected networks.

Directed networks led into previous scale-free networks, and we consider that some infectious diseases do not have full immunity.

So we use strong self-protection instead of immunity and establish a semidirected network infectious disease model without full immunity.

The basic reproduction number R0 is calculated.

If R0<1, the disease-free equilibrium E0 is locally and globally asymptotically stable.

And the endemic equilibrium E∗ is globally asymptotically stable in some condition.

A large number of simulation results in this paper verify the correctness of the above conclusions and provide a solution for controlling disease transmission in the future.
